The charming town of Guisborough is located in the borough of Redcar. Guisborough has heaps of charm and character. Michael Poole Estate Agents Guisborough is located in Guisborough town centre and sits on 10 Chaloner Street. Despite being a small town, Guisborough has a lot to offer. Guisborough town is overflowing with fantastic independent shops and well-known high street brands that provide everything you could need locally. Along with other businesses, there are bakeries, florists, hair salons, butchers, fish and chip shops, and more. Guisborough is also home to a tonne of fantastic restaurants and bars. One of Guisborough's most well-known neighbourhoods in Hunters Hill, which includes a range of housing, from apartments to upscale detached houses. Galley Hill and Pine Hills are both well-liked neighbourhoods for families because of how close they are to the local primary schools. Guisborough has a great history, one of the most famous aspects being the Guisborough Priory. The Guisborough Priory is a beautiful, ruined abbey that stands perfectly inside the town, delivering a taste of excellent gothic architecture. Guisborough forest provides walking options for keen walkers and biking tracks for bike enthusiasts. Guisborough Forest is located between Teesside and the North York Moors, Mountain bikes, horses, and skateboards are all permitted. You can see why it is rated the third best "thing to do" in Guisborough on TripAdvisor. There is even a café with a visitor's centre, making it ideal for a family day out!
